In the following question, two statements and five
connectors are given. Only one of the connectors from those given can be used to combine the given two statements into one sentence without changing the meaning. Choose that connector as your answer. I. Britain and Argentina fought a brief war over the Falkland Islands in 1982 and Britain won that war. II. Argentina continues to claim the islands, which it refers to as Las Malvinas.Solution
The given sentences are contradictory in nature. Sentence I seeks to convey that Britain and Argentina fought a war over the Falkland Islands in 1982 and Britain won it. Sentence II presents a contradiction by stating that despite the victory of Britain, Argentina still continues its claim over the islands and calls them by the name of Las Malvinas. BUT is used to present a contradiction and can be used to join the two sentences: "Britain and Argentina fought a brief war over the Falkland Islands in 1982 and Britain won that war but Argentina continues to claim the islands, which it refers to as Las Malvinas." Therefore, C is the right answer.
